ZHCUCS8 February   2025 AFE7728D , AFE7768D , AFE7769D

 

  1.   1
  2.   摘要
  3.   商标
  4. 1引言
  5. 2硬件和软件设置
    1. 2.1 硬件设置
    2. 2.2 软件设置
    3. 2.3 测试用例
      1. 2.3.1 所有测试用例的初始启动
        1. 2.3.1.1 测试用例 1:从 NCO @ 5MHz 生成正弦 TX_DATA
        2. 2.3.1.2 测试用例 2:从 NCO @ 20MHz 生成正弦 TX_DATA
        3. 2.3.1.3 测试用例 3:将信号发生器输出端口连接到 AFE7769DEVM 的 RX(输出功率为 -13dBm)
        4. 2.3.1.4 测试用例 4:将信号发生器输出端口连接到 AFE7769DEVM 的 RX(输出功率为 -23dBm)

所有测试用例的初始启动

  1. 启动 AFE77xxD Latte GUI。
  2. 将弹出一个包含设备设置信息的初始窗口;验证该窗口的设置是否与 图 2-2 中所示完全相同。
     初始设置,AFE77xxD图 2-2 初始设置,AFE77xxD
  3. 导航到应用左侧的“AFE-Configuration”(AFE-配置)选项卡,然后选择“Load”(加载)“AFE77xxD_8.1_9.1.xlsx”文件。
  4. 确保加载配置文件后“Log”(日志)窗口中显示以下消息:
    1. 加载的配置:“AFE77xxD_8.1_9.1.xlsx”
    2. 已刷新 GUI。
  5. 先不要单击 Latte 中的“Run Device Bringup”(运行器件启动)。
  6. 保持 Latte 打开;启动 Quartus Programmer。
  7. 单击窗格顶部的“Hardware Setup”(硬件设置),并确保选中“USB-BlasterII [USB-1]”。
     硬件设置窗口图 2-3 硬件设置窗口
  8. 单击“Auto Detect”(自动检测),随后将弹出一个包含不同 FPGA 名称的窗口。选择 10AS066N2 并单击“OK”。
     自动检测窗口图 2-4 自动检测窗口
  9. 在中间窗格中,将显示一个由四个部分组成的方框图。参考“File”(文件)列中块的顺序,选择第三个块(也称为“1_BIT_TAP”块),然后单击“Delete”(删除)。
     移除“1_BIT_TAP”图 2-5 移除“1_BIT_TAP”
  10. 接下来,选择同一“File”(文件)列中的第一个块,然后单击“Change File”(更改文件)。
     更改“10AS066N2”图 2-6 更改“10AS066N2”
  11. 在文件资源管理器中,选择“j204b_test.sof”文件并单击“Open”(打开)。
     插入 .sof 文件图 2-7 插入 .sof 文件
  12. 验证方框图是否与下图完全相同,尤其是在顺序方面。
     更新了方框图图 2-8 更新了方框图
  13. 导航回 Latte,然后单击“Run Device Bringup”(运行器件启动)。
  14. 监控“Log”(日志)窗口。看到“LMK Configured”(已配置 LMK)消息后,导航回 Quartus Programmer 并单击“Start”(开始)。
     “LMK Configured”指示器图 2-9 “LMK Configured”指示器
  15. 在 Quartus Programmer 中,监控窗口右上角的进度条。进度条将在一分钟内达到“100% (Successful)”(100%(成功))。
  16. 返回 Latte GUI 并监控器件启动,直到完成。完成标志是“Log”(日志)窗口中显示“AFE configuration complete”(AFE 配置完成)的最终消息,以及错误和警告数量记录。
  17. 启动结束时,“Log”(日志)窗口仅通知用户两个错误(无警告),其中包括两次“FPGA Reset device not found”(未找到 FPGA 复位器件)。这是正常现象,无需担心,因为 Latte 目前只能识别 TSW14J58EVM,即一款 TI FPGA。